黑狐家游戏

分布式部署和集群部署的区别,分布式部署与集群部署,深入解析两者的区别与联系

欧气 0 0

本文目录导读:

分布式部署和集群部署的区别,分布式部署与集群部署,深入解析两者的区别与联系

图片来源于网络,如有侵权联系删除

  1. 分布式部署
  2. 集群部署
  3. 分布式部署与集群部署的区别

在当今信息技术高速发展的时代,分布式部署和集群部署已经成为企业构建高性能、高可用性系统的首选方案,虽然两者都旨在提高系统的性能和可靠性,但它们在架构、实现方式、应用场景等方面存在显著差异,本文将深入解析分布式部署与集群部署的区别,帮助读者更好地理解这两种部署模式。

分布式部署

分布式部署是指将应用程序或数据分散部署在多个节点上,通过网络进行通信和协作,共同完成业务逻辑的处理,分布式部署具有以下特点:

1、弹性伸缩:分布式系统可以根据业务需求动态调整节点数量,实现横向扩展。

2、高可用性:分布式系统通过节点冗余,即使部分节点故障,系统仍能正常运行。

3、资源共享:分布式系统可以实现资源的高效利用,降低单点故障风险。

4、异构性:分布式系统支持不同类型的硬件和软件平台,具有良好的兼容性。

5、可扩展性:分布式系统可以通过增加节点来提高性能,满足业务需求。

分布式部署和集群部署的区别,分布式部署与集群部署,深入解析两者的区别与联系

图片来源于网络,如有侵权联系删除

集群部署

集群部署是指将多个服务器通过网络连接在一起,形成一个高性能、高可用的计算集群,集群部署具有以下特点:

1、高性能:集群通过并行处理任务,提高计算速度。

2、高可用性:集群通过冗余设计,确保系统在节点故障时仍能正常运行。

3、简单易用:集群部署相对简单,只需配置好集群节点即可。

4、资源共享:集群节点共享存储资源,提高数据访问速度。

5、灵活性:集群可以根据业务需求动态调整节点数量和配置。

分布式部署与集群部署的区别

1、架构差异:分布式部署强调节点间的通信和协作,而集群部署侧重于节点间的并行计算。

分布式部署和集群部署的区别,分布式部署与集群部署,深入解析两者的区别与联系

图片来源于网络,如有侵权联系删除

2、节点关系:分布式部署中,节点之间是平等的关系,而集群部署中,节点之间存在主从关系。

3、可扩展性:分布式部署支持横向扩展,而集群部署主要支持纵向扩展。

4、应用场景:分布式部署适用于大规模、高并发的业务场景,如分布式数据库、分布式文件系统等;集群部署适用于高性能计算、高性能存储等场景。

5、资源利用率:分布式部署具有较高的资源利用率,而集群部署的资源利用率相对较低。

分布式部署与集群部署在提高系统性能和可靠性方面具有相似之处,但它们在架构、实现方式、应用场景等方面存在显著差异,企业在选择部署模式时,应根据自身业务需求、资源状况等因素进行综合考虑,通过深入了解分布式部署与集群部署的区别,有助于企业构建更加高效、稳定的系统。

标签: #分布式 部署

黑狐家游戏
  • 评论列表

留言评论